apache it gets better around day 10 of the trial if you do your training and mining right.


first train Learning and all the other Learning skills (iron will, analytical mind, etc) to level3.

(this takes about 5 days)

Then go for frigate 3.

then go for industrial skill 1 so you can have an industrial ship to haul your mined ore.

then go for Anchoring skill so you can buy and use secure containers.

If you mine while all these train (suggest you team up with others to mine faster) you will have enough money to buy the industrial ship and the container.

When you get all that you can go ahead and mine real good while you train the skills in the ship you want to be flying in (cruiser or interceptor of frigate or industrial).

The Bantam is nice. If your mining alone, it's not a bad platform. Room for drones and a couple of hardpoints for lasers, unfortunately no weapons. If you're working with a group and have a Badger nearby to do the hauling, the Merlin is better. The cargo hold is smaller, but you'll just be dropping cans so it makes little difference. The chief advantage is the missile rails. With these, you can defend the group and mine at the same time.
